COMMERCIAL.
LONDON MARKETS. . ! By Cable—Press Association —Copyright. London, December 9. At the? wool sales, 47,000 bales were sold, for Home consumption, the same for the Continent, 1000 for the United States, and 2000 bales were held over. Dalgety and Co., Ltd., Wellington, have been advised from their London office by cable, under date of sth inst, as follows: Frozen meat —Market quiet. Mutton—Prices are from par to y 8 d higher. Lamb—Poor demand, prices unchanged. Beef—Poor demand; holders are firm At laat quotation. Tallow—For good beef and muttoa, since our last cable, prices are unchanged. For good colored mixed or beef prices are 3d per cwt. higher, other descripi tions 6d per cwt. higher. ARGENTINE MEAT EXPORTS. By Telegraph—Press Association. Wellington, Tuesday. The Department of Commerce has received the following cablegram from Buenos Aires dated December 9:—The following shipments of produce have been despatched from the Argentine to United Kingdom ports during November, 1912. compared with November, 1011: —Frozen beef, 1912, 145,000 quarters. 1911, 122.000 quarters; chilled beef, quarters. 170,000 (190.000); frozen mutton, earcases, 208,000 (270,000); frozen lamb, carcases, 93,000 (117,000); butter, cwts., 14,900 (0802).
